Abstract :
Nowadays the consumption of electrical energy is increased together with more complexity of power system structure and interconnection of its components. According to these facts, to control the power system synchronous generators (SG) with regard to their non-linearity, multi-dimensionality and multi-linkage properties we need to use a fundamentally new approach, namely system-cybernetic one. The paper presents a synergistic synthesis procedure of nonlinear adaptive control law for power system SG excitation in accordance with the principle of integral adaptation of synergetic control theory. The synthesized control law provides implementation of technological invariants, i.e. stabilization of terminal voltage and synchronous operation with network, suppression of parametric perturbation (parametric robustness). Comparative analysis of stability area of the synergistic law with conventional SG excitation control illustrates the significant advantage of the synergetic approach in increasing the power system reliability.
